Forum Clubic

Utilité de superfetch?

Je voulais avoir un avis general sur l’utilité du superfetch de vista ; Aussi, la mise en cache excessive de la mémoire pour accelerer le démarage ou les applications ne nuit il pas finallement au systeme? Alors réelle optimisation ou pas? Pour ma part, je ne suis pas convaincu ,aussi ne vaudrait il pas mieux le desactiver? PS: j’ai 2 raptors et 3.5Go de mémoires vives reconnues.

Il semblerait qu’il ai en effet une amelioration des performances avec superfetch. En fait il charge au demarrage (progrssivement pas tout d’un coup) les fichiers les plus courement utilisés grace a un algorithme. Donc quand on lance une application les fichiers necessaires sont en general deja chargés. Je l’ai laissé activé et il tourne a merveille. J’avais testé sans cette fonctionnalité, en virant pas mal d’autres choses aussi, et le systeme avait l’air trop lourd. (J’avais pas SP1 aussi a ce moment la). Mais la ca va impec. J’ai 4Go de ram et j’ai l’impression qu’il les utilisent vraiment bien.
Edité le 14/03/2008 à 14:59

Pourquoi la mise en cache nuierait-elle au systeme ?

Bien au contraire cela apporter des données directement accessibles sans avoir à les chercher sur le point le plus lent de tout le PC: le disque dur (meme avec un 12 Raptors)

Si tu parle de consommation RAM “excessive” sache simplement que l’OS ne fait qu’exploiter la mémoire disponible et inutilisée.En cas de besoin par une application tiers la mémoire est tout simplement libérée. Et quand je dis libéré ce n’est pas une ecirutre du cache sur le disque puis vidange de la zone mémoire, non c’est tout simplement une libération de la zone mémoire, en permettant à l’application d’ecrire par dessus.
Une fois que l’application n’a plus besoin de l’espace mémoire l’OS va progressivement recharger les informations du cache en mémoire.

Personnellement j’y vois un gain notable sur des applications gourmandes comme celles que j’utilise professionnellement.

Sur ma machine perso en Vista les meme appli se lancent plus rapidement que sur celle du boulot qui a une config similaire mais sous XP pro et avec 4Go de RAM au liue de 2Go chez moi.

D’ailleur il suffit de lancer 2-3 fois ne serait-ce que Word pour voir la différence. Apres le gain est essentiellem propre à l’usage qu’on fait du PC.
Si tu utilises toujours la meme application (genre ton navigateur web) tu ne verras aucun gain, vu qu’il n’y a rien à precharger. Mais si tu es du genre à basculer sans cesses entre pleins d’applications plus ou moins gourmande ça sera tres benefique.A noter que la taille du cache sera dans le deuxieme cas bien evidemment plus importante, ce qui se comprend.

OK sur des applications bureautiques , je suis en partie d’accord avec toi! Mais je persiste et signe :Sur des applications lourdes ,notamment en montage video Ex: sous Premiere que j’utilise assez regulierement !Qui plus est en mode HD et ou la swap est tres importante , pour moi la difference est nette .Ou alors c’est que le temps de liberation de cette fameuse zone mémoire est trop long! Quoi qu’il en soit ,je me doutais un peu de vos réponses ,seulement voila ,le hic c’est qu’ apparemment les avis divergent! et c’est d’ailleurs ce qui m’a poussé à poser cette question ! je me refere tout simplement à l’article fraichement lue du dernier Windows vista Mag (officiel) N°16 Page 9. Je ne vous citerais pas le texte , libre à vous de vous y réferer!

Ca depend forcement des applications aussi … elles sont loin d’etre toutes programmées de la meme maniere. J’ai pas dit que le systeme etait parfait mais c’est quand meme bien mieux géré que sur XP ca ne fait aucun doute. J’etais sceptique au debut mais plus maintenant.

Et comme je n’ai pas Premiere, je ne peux pas comparer avec toi, en tout cas, 3D Studio Max 2008, Photoshop ou encore XSI se chargent très rapidement.

Applications personnellement utilisées:

Autocad
Allplan
Cinema4D
Photoshop
Sony Vegas Video

C’est quasi instantané. il a juste à rendre l’accès possible… l’application ecris alors dans la zone memoire comme s’il n’y avait jamais rien eut

Que fais-tu exactement pour en arriver là ?

Si tu veux en apprendre plus il existe des webcast sur le site MSDN dont une parle du superfecth montrant clairement comment ça marche:

www.microsoft.com…

Il suffit d’avoir un compte liveID pour y acceder et voir la vidéo

Personellement j’utilise allplan, autocad, eovia carrara, archicad, photoshop et j’aprécie nettement chez moi la rapidité de Vista comparer aux PC de mon travail avec XP.

+1 pour Superfetch